The Paleo diet is all about keeping things natural. It’s like turning back the clock to ancient times when our ancestors hunted and gathered their meals. Grains and processed stuff? Not so much. So, where do smoothies fit in this whole hunter-gatherer scenario? Well, they’re more welcome than you’d think — as long as you’re sticking to ingredients that would be familiar to our Paleo predecessors.
Think of a smoothie as a blank canvas. By choosing fruits and vegetables that are fresh and full of nutrients, you’re aligning perfectly with Paleo guidelines. No hidden sugars or processed additives here! Just blend up some fresh berries or a handful of leafy greens. These ingredients pack a big nutrient punch and add a burst of color and flavor to your morning routine.
Protein and healthy fats are a must when you’re whipping up a Paleo smoothie. Almonds, coconut milk, or even avocado are fantastic for adding that creamy texture and satisfying your hunger. They help keep you full longer and add a creamy richness that’s hard to beat. Trust me, once you start blending in these delightful additions, your Paleo smoothie game is about to get super exciting.
Let’s talk about sweeteners, though. Using stuff like honey, dates, or even a ripe banana can sweeten things up naturally and still keep you on the Paleo track. Just keep an eye on portion sizes. It’s all about balance, and these natural sweeteners should give your smoothie just the right taste lift without overloading you on sugars.

Boosting Nutrition: The Healthiest Ingredients for Paleo Smoothies
For any smoothie to be genuinely satisfying, loading up on nutrient-dense goodies is a must. In the Paleo world, we’re all about those superfoods that pack a punch. Green veggies, like kale or spinach, not only give your drink a vibrant color but are also brimming with vitamins and minerals. They blend well and add just the right touch of earthiness to balance sweeter fruits.
Healthy fats and proteins aren’t just extras; they’re essentials. Almonds, chia seeds, and nut butters give your smoothie that creamy texture while fueling you with energy and keeping those hunger pangs at bay. These ingredients help ensure your smoothie isn’t just a quick sugar rush but something that keeps you going for hours. Plus, the omega-3 fatty acids in chia seeds? Your body will thank you!
When it comes to sweeteners, the natural route is always the winner. Dates or a drizzle of honey bring that perfect sweetness without the guilt. Moderation is the key here. Also, ripe fruits like bananas can naturally sweeten the deal. They’re like nature’s candy, giving you just the right amount of sweetness and potassium for that post-workout recovery.

The Mediterranean Connection: Bridging Paleo and Mediterranean Diets with Smoothies
Smoothies and the Mediterranean diet might not seem like an obvious pairing, but they have more in common than you’d expect. Both emphasize whole, natural ingredients, and fresh fruits and veggies are a prominent feature in both eating styles — making smoothies a common ground that fans of both diets can enjoy.
In the Mediterranean diet, it’s all about complementing flavors with healthy fats and a limited focus on dairy. This sets a stage for a rich, creamy smoothie by including elements like olive oil or a handful of nuts. When whipped up with Paleo-friendly ingredients, you get the best of both worlds — a smoothie that respects both dietary guidelines while tantalizing your taste buds.
Common ingredients across both diets, like avocados and berries, create a nutritional powerhouse in your glass. Avocados lend that lush, creamy texture, while berries are great for adding antioxidants with a sweet punch. Both are staples that work beautifully together, making them ideal for your smoothie-making exploits.
Let’s add a sample recipe into the mix: Start with a base of almond milk, throw in a few berries, half an avocado, a teaspoon of olive oil, and a sprinkle of crushed nuts. Blend it until smooth. It’s that simple! This drink captures the harmony of Mediterranean freshness with the hunter-gatherer spirit of Paleo.
